Output 76c879a667e65e1e39ee8d9a6b2590b9f4577b8875f6517decc37831f02885bc:5

value
28600451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f2e4bf7f5f7d394f832299256a71071d8a526a0 OP_EQUALVERIFY OP_CHECKSIG
address
16m52qiyAeBZfc5BeWyjJD9Fgc3zakRdwg
transaction
76c879a667e65e1e39ee8d9a6b2590b9f4577b8875f6517decc37831f02885bc
spent
true